New Deputy Principal for Curriculum appointed at The Sheffield College

11th November 2025

A new Deputy Principal for Curriculum has been appointed at The Sheffield College.

Hayley Phare has more than 20 years’ experience of working in education.  

Prior to joining The Sheffield College, Hayley was Group Executive Director of Curriculum at South Essex College Group.

Hayley said: “I am really excited about joining The Sheffield College and delivering a curriculum that keeps pace with industry and prepares students for work and life.”

“The college plays a major role in the city and has made significant strides in recent years, which is something I wanted to be part of,” added Hayley.

Hayley’s expertise spans education leadership and management as well as curriculum planning and development. She started in post on 29th September 2025.

Hayley began her career as a secondary school English teacher before moving onto the further education sector, initially as a head of department. 

Her remit has covered adult education, engineering, construction, service industries, and the launch of A Levels, T Levels and Higher Technical Qualifications.

Angela Foulkes CBE, Chief Executive and Principal, The Sheffield College, said: “Hayley’s wide ranging knowledge and expertise will play a pivotal role ensuring the college is a great place to learn. I am delighted to welcome Hayley to the college.”

The college provides a broad curriculum that includes apprenticeships, vocational diplomas, A Levels, T Levels, access courses, and foundation and honours degrees, and has five main campuses across Sheffield.

The latest Strategic Plan 2025 – 2030 outlines the college’s top priorities which focus on four key themes: learning, people, partnerships and sustainability.

As part of the learning theme, the college is committed to delivering a curriculum that keeps pace with industry, prepares students for work and life and provides high quality teaching, learning and assessment. 

Creating a safe, respectful and inclusive environment where students are listened to is also a priority.
